A question I often get is how do I take care of my body while sewing? I think we can all agree it is very important to take care of our creative tools. We can’t sew if our sewing machines need repair or our scissors aren’t sharp. Well, whatever the creative practice you have is, your body is as much of a tool for creating as the machines, brushes, kilns, instruments, etc. are. Part of building a sustainable creative practice (and business if that is what you are doing) is making sure that the bodies involved are cared for and are not being harmed, which includes your own body!
